Mold Swab Testing Explained for Homeowners
Microbial growth in homes represents a significant health and structural concern for Alabama homeowners. Understanding mold swab testing provides critical insights into potential environmental risks lurking within your property. Mold testing helps identify hidden microbial threats before they escalate into serious health or structural problems.
Mold swab testing involves a precise scientific process designed to collect surface samples for laboratory analysis. Here’s how professionals conduct these specialized examinations:
Trained inspectors use sterile swabs to collect samples from suspicious surfaces
Samples are carefully transferred to controlled laboratory environments
Microscopic examination identifies specific mold species and concentrations
Results provide detailed information about potential health risks and recommended remediation strategies
The testing process focuses on identifying areas with potential moisture problems. Surface sampling allows inspectors to determine whether visible discoloration represents active microbial growth. Microscopic sample analysis reveals critical details about mold types, concentrations, and potential health implications.
Professional mold swab testing offers several key advantages for homeowners:
Precise identification of specific mold species
Quantitative assessment of microbial presence
Targeted recommendations for remediation
Documentation for potential insurance or legal purposes
Comprehensive understanding of indoor air quality
Mold thrives in moisture-rich environments, making prevention as important as detection.

How Certified Inspectors Perform the Test
Certified home inspectors follow a meticulous and scientific approach when conducting microbial growth investigations across Alabama homes. Certified mold testing procedures involve systematic sampling techniques designed to provide accurate and comprehensive environmental assessments.
Professional inspectors utilize multiple sampling methods to ensure thorough investigation:
Surface swab sampling from suspicious areas
Air sampling using specialized collection devices
Tape lift sampling for surface microbial identification
Bulk material sampling from potentially contaminated surfaces
Visual comprehensive inspection of moisture-prone zones
The testing process involves several critical steps to guarantee reliable results. Professional sampling techniques require careful collection, documentation, and laboratory analysis to determine the precise nature and extent of potential microbial growth.
Here’s a quick comparison of popular mold sampling methods used by professionals:
Sampling Method | What It Detects | Typical Use Case | Specialized Equipment Needed |
Swab Sampling | Surface mold species | Small, visible suspect areas | Sterile swabs |
Air Sampling | Airborne mold spores | Investigating indoor air quality | Air collection pumps |
Tape Lift Sampling | Surface mold and particles | Non-destructive spot checks | Clear adhesive tape slides |
Bulk Material Sampling | Mold within materials | Deep contamination investigations | Sealable sample containers |
Key aspects of a comprehensive mold investigation include:
Initial property moisture assessment
Strategic sampling point selection
Precise sample collection using calibrated equipment
Laboratory microscopic and cultural analysis
Detailed reporting with scientific recommendations
Certified inspectors understand that accurate testing requires more than simple visual examination.

Understanding Results and Next Steps
Deciphering mold test results requires careful interpretation and strategic planning for Alabama homeowners. Mold report analysis involves understanding the laboratory findings to determine potential health risks and necessary remediation strategies.
There are several critical components in a comprehensive mold testing report:
Specific mold species identification
Concentration levels of microbial growth
Location and extent of contamination
Potential health impact assessment
Moisture source recommendations
Certified inspectors provide detailed insights that help homeowners make informed decisions. Mold remediation guidelines emphasize that visible mold presence always requires action, regardless of test result specifics.
Key steps after receiving your mold test results include:
Review the detailed laboratory report
Identify the primary moisture sources
Develop a comprehensive remediation plan
Address underlying structural moisture issues
Schedule professional cleanup and prevention services
Mold testing is not just about identification, but understanding the environmental conditions that enable growth.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is mold swab testing?
Mold swab testing is a scientific process used to collect surface samples from potential microbial growth areas in homes, which are then analyzed in a laboratory to identify specific mold species and their concentrations.
When should I consider mold swab testing for my home?
Consider mold swab testing if you or your family experience unexplained respiratory issues, detect persistent musty odors, experience recent water damage, or are purchasing a new home that may have hidden moisture problems.
How do certified inspectors perform mold swab tests?
Certified inspectors collect samples using sterile swabs from suspicious surfaces, utilize various sampling methods like air sampling and tape lift sampling, and conduct a thorough visual inspection to ensure accurate and reliable results.
What should I do after receiving my mold test results?
After receiving your mold test results, review the detailed laboratory report, identify moisture sources, develop a remediation plan, and address any underlying structural issues to prevent further microbial growth.
